How similar are IWM and VBR?
iShares Russell 2000 ETF (IWM, by iShares) holds 1941 positions; Vanguard Small-cap Value Index Fund (VBR, by Vanguard) holds 838. They have 430 holdings in common, and by portfolio weight the two funds are 25.6% identical. In practical terms the pair is lightly overlapping, with most of each portfolio distinct.

Sector Breakdown
| Sector | IWM | VBR |
|---|---|---|
| Industrials | 17.9% | 18.8% |
| Financials | 15.3% | 18.7% |
| Health Care | 16.6% | 8.4% |
| Information Technology | 13.6% | 8.2% |
| Consumer Discretionary | 8.0% | 10.9% |
| Other Sectors | 22.7% | 34.3% |
| Unclassified | 5.5% | 0.5% |
Share of each fund's portfolio weight by GICS-style sector, compiled from issuer fund data and our own classification of the holdings, not the issuers' published sector charts. “Unclassified” is weight we could not classify (5% of IWM, 1% of VBR).

Frequently Asked Questions
How much do IWM and VBR overlap?
IWM and VBR overlap by 25.6% of portfolio weight. They share 430 holdings (IWM holds 1941 positions and VBR holds 838), based on each fund's latest SEC-reported holdings.
Is it redundant to own both IWM and VBR?
The two portfolios are 25.6% identical by weight. Owning both is not redundant. Most of each portfolio is distinct, so the funds can serve different roles.
What are the biggest shared holdings of IWM and VBR?
The largest positions held by both funds are MOG-A, WTS, ECHO, ONB and UMBF. Together the top 10 shared positions account for 7% of the total overlap.
What does IWM own that VBR doesn't?
1511 positions (61.1% of IWM) are unique to IWM, led by BE, CDE and FN. In the other direction, 408 positions (74.2% of VBR) are unique to VBR.
